Transaction 77b18de80c5b098cc1557c99815f2e6a9598a658f88f20c150809f0233ff81d6
1 Input
1 Output
-
77b18de80c5b098cc1557c99815f2e6a9598a658f88f20c150809f0233ff81d6:0
- value
- 20454592
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c4bc638d783b8c6bccb2607d77155a31d9b8dfe
- address
- bc1q939uvwxhswuvd0xtycrawu245vwehr07ef0ec7